A 7-day journey exploring humility and dependence on God and others for men entering their final season.
Welcome to this 7-day Bible study focused on the unique journey men face as they learn to embrace humility and ask for help, especially in their later years. Often, men are taught to be self-reliant and strong, but God calls us to recognize the strength found in dependence — both on Him and on the community He places around us.
In this season of life, whether transitioning into retirement, facing health challenges, or reflecting on a lifetime of accomplishments, the ability to ask for help becomes a vital skill rooted in faith and trust. This study offers a biblical perspective to encourage vulnerability, humility, and the courage to seek support.
Throughout these seven days, we will explore Scripture passages highlighting men who demonstrated strength through surrender and reliance on God and others. Our key focus is on developing a heart posture that honors God by embracing human need, letting go of pride, and welcoming community. You will be invited to reflect, journal, and pray, fostering an authentic connection with God and your brothers in faith.
Remember, humility is not weakness, but a powerful indication of trusting God’s timing and provision. Asking for help is a courageous step toward deeper fellowship and spiritual growth as you navigate this chapter of life.
